The painting depicted on this scarf, of a youth holding a pomegranate, reflects the style of the 17th Century artist, Reza ‘Abbasi. He was the most gifted painter at the court of Shah ‘Abbas in Isfahan, and his work inspired many adaptations by other artists of the Safavid era. Pomegranates are a common subject in Persian art, and they symbolise fertility, life, and eternal life The painting is now in the collection of Cleveland Museum of Art, Cleveland, Ohio.
